Hearing rumors of some kind of event up in Norway associated with the name of Hammerfest, I loaded up my old Sikorsky S43 (Bill Lyons version)at Merc Air HQ in southern England and decided to head up there to check it out. Maybe even see if I can get a good deal on some ball peens for AP adjustments. Leaving Rochford behind, my first leg is a quick dash across the channel to Ostende to load up on some Jupiler beer for the trip.

About halfway across the Channel, I flew over an older aircraft carrier. Once I got near the coast, everything fogged in and I had to feel my way with help of the radio compass to find the airport. Made it down safely and found a parking spot next to a fine ol' DC-6 freighter.

Off to go load up on some beer...... :icon29:
 
Headed on north to Lelystad, Holland. What I'm actually doing is testing out stuff prior to our race from Norway to South Africa. This flight was with everything running to see if anything would break. It held up and everything seems to be working. Now to get a little flight time in the Sikorsky before we start....

Pete, I get the Swedish Bikini Team to do my polishing. It's quite the show :icon_lol:. This was an early bare metal for me. I don't do that much shine on them these days.

Jagd, the Norwegian airline DNL flew a S43 for a while in the '30s so there is a history for them in Europe. I think I was one of Bill Lyons' first sales of Golden Hawaii when I pre-ordered it after he released the first beta shots of the S43. Haven't flown it much in the past few years, but that's about to change for our race.

Our race is going to be from the Norwegian Arctic to Cape Town South Africa and is for mid '30s and modern GA aircraft. Advance details are in the multiplayer forum and we're hoping to have the final rules released in the next day or so. Look for Cape to Cape.
